Metadata Development Unit (MDU)

The Metadata Development Unit specializes in cataloging select monographs unique to Stanford, as well as most non-book materials. While most of the new acquisitions at Stanford are copy-cataloged through a combination of vendor-supplied cataloging and local copy cataloging, these streamlined processes are not available or appropriate for all materials. Many of the more esoteric and priority monographs fall in the special category cataloged by the MDU staff, as do non-book formats, including serials, selected audiovisual materials, and electronic resources. Catalogers in the Unit apply PCC standards as a default and contribute to the BIBCO, NACO, and SACO cooperative cataloging programs, including the NACO Hebraica Funnel (hosted at Stanford).
